Enable BitLocker To enable BitLocker on your device, use these steps: … WebBitLocker To Go is BitLocker Drive Encryption on removable data drives. This feature includes the encryption of: USB flash drives SD cards External hard disk drives Other drives that are formatted by using the NTFS, FAT16, FAT32, or exFAT file system. Drive partitioning must meet the BitLocker Drive Encryption Partitioning Requirements.

WebJan 23, 2024 · Here are the steps for implementing BitLocker Network Unlock. 1: The device must have UEFI firmware and UEFI DHCP capability. 2: Any UEFI Compatibility Support Modules (CSM)/Legacy modes must be disabled. 3: The BitLocker-Network Unlock feature must be installed on a Windows Deployment Server. WebJan 10, 2011 · Part 1: What Is BitLocker? BitLocker Drive Encryption, or simply BitLocker, is an encryption software that Microsoft introduced to protect user data. It seamlessly integrates with the operating system and prevents hackers and cybercriminals from stealing or viewing data stored on the drive. WebSelect Start > Settings > Privacy & security > Device encryption. If Device encryption doesn't appear, it isn't available. You may be able to use standard BitLocker encryption instead. Open Device encryption in Settings. If Device encryption is turned off, turn it On. Turn on standard BitLocker encryption

If your hard drive needs data recovery, the biggest obstacle in your way might be yourself. Microsoft’s BitLocker encryption will prevent any successful data recovery attempt unless you have the backup key.
